Technical Details of Predator Galea 350 Gaming Headset
- Type: Stereo headset
- Connection: USB - Wired and 3.5 mm mini-phone
- Impedance: 32 Ohm
- Frequency response: 20 Hz – 20 kHz
- Design: Over-the-head, binaural, circumaural
- Cable length: 3.94 ft
- Microphone: Noise-cancelling microphone
- Color: Black
